On Fri, Feb 15, 2019 at 11:09:49AM +0100, Ismael Bouya wrote:
> Hi Rudolf,
> You should add this in your configuration file:
> ```
> folder-hook . 'set record="^"'
> ```

> (Fri, Feb 15, 2019 at 11:04:26AM +0100) Rudolf Bahr :
> > Hello All!
> > 
> > This is my first post here.
> > 
> > Please, what is the right command in order to get a copy of a written
> > and sent mail into the same folder where it was produced?
> > Up to now NeoMutt's automatic Fcc: request points always to the same 
> > folder.

Hi Ismael,

I fear it won't work in the intended way. Id did so as you suggested and inserted
folder-hook . 'set record="^"'
into my .muttrc-file.

For instance, I have written this mail here in my folder "=mutt/" and would like to 
have suggested it to be saved here, but after ending it, mutt's proposal is: 
Fcc: =neomutt-users at neomutt.org
which doesn't exist as folder.

Any idea what could be wrong?
